Usage Note
Diverso shifts meaning by position: un diverso approccio (a different approach) when placed before the noun, but persone diverse (various / several people) in the plural before a noun. It is NOT a false friend for English 'diverse' — use it freely for 'different' in everyday speech. Feminine: diversa; plural: diversi / diverse.
Examples
"Oggi mi sento diverso dal solito."
Natural Translation
Today I feel different from usual.
